Hello! On Wix, such integration is handled by Velo: I conduct the payment through http-functions as a backend endpoint that catches the serviceUrl callback from WayForPay. I update the order status specifically through this callback with a check of the merchantSignature (HMAC-MD5), not through a redirect from the front end, because user return can be easily faked and the payment may remain unpaid. In response, I send an accept confirmation to WayForPay; otherwise, it will keep retrying. I place the updated status in the Wix Data collection in the format that your CRM expects for routing. Your main pain point here is not the payment itself, but the seamless connection of three links: WayForPay → Wix database → CRM, without manual gaps and status breaks. Custom integration through Wix Velo (HTTP functions for webhooks and Wix Data collections) closes this chain — the payment webhook from WayForPay instantly updates the order record, and the HTTP request to the CRM triggers routing for managers.

The first step before any code is a technical audit of your Wix plan: not all plans allow external API calls and custom HTTP functions, so without this check, we risk hitting a dead end in the middle of implementation. It is also worth immediately fixing the list of specific CRM systems and fields being transmitted — the plural "CRM systems" in the requirements can easily grow into a scope expansion at the acceptance stage.

The webhook handler itself is implemented as a separate HTTP function in Wix Velo with WayForPay signature verification — this is critical because without verifying each callback, anyone can spoof the payment status. After verification, the record is updated in the Wix Data collection, and then the webhook or direct API call transmits the status to the CRM. This architecture with two stages (record in Wix → transmission to CRM) gives you repeatability: even if the CRM is temporarily unavailable, the status is not lost because it is already saved in the Wix database.

It is necessary to connect WayForPay with Wix so that payments are processed on the site, the status is immediately written in the Wix CMS, and it goes further to the CRM without manual intervention.

Here’s how I am building it: through Wix Velo (JavaScript on the backend), I create a serverless endpoint that generates a signature and sends a request to the WayForPay API. After payment, WayForPay sends a webhook to this same endpoint, which verifies the signature (critical, because without checking HMAC-SHA1, fake callbacks can be received), updates the record in Wix Data, and triggers the status transfer to the CRM via an HTTP request or Wix Automations.

Key risk: Wix blocks external fetch requests from the client side, so all logic with secret keys and webhooks must reside exclusively in the Wix Backend (web-modules), otherwise the merchantSecret will be exposed in the browser.
